TUESDAY 14th October 2003
MIDLAND COMBINATION PREMIER
COVENTRY SPHINX 2 v 1 COLESHILL TOWN
Scorer: Craig Davies.

This game was to be Tony Gormey's last one in charge as he stepped down immediately after the final whistle. Gormley is not walking away from the club but is will to stay on in whatever capacity he is needed. Joint management duo Pete Wilson and Mick Beadle will take over team affairs on a caretaker basis while the club advertise the vacant position. Wilson and Beadle have indicated they will apply for the job and if the can turn it round in the next few weeks, they look to be favourites.

For the game against Sphinx, Gormley again struggled to field a side relying on short-term replacements and youth team players. Coleshill usually struggle against Sphinx as they are a big powerful side, and this game proved no different but Town stood up to the challenge and had the home team worried until they finally ran out of steam in the last quarter of the game. Danny Moseley pulled off several outstanding saves to keep the Sphinx forwards at bay, bringing the comment from the home management "Trust us to play a team with Gordon Banks in goal". The ten players in front of Moseley worked tirelessly to restrict Sphinx and the hard work paid off when Danny Carter jinked his way to the penalty area before feeding Craig Davies who rounded the keeper and shot into an empty net for his twelfth of the season.

A 1-0 half time score lifted everybody in the dressing room but Sphinx came out for the second half with renewed vigour and Town had their backs against the wall, even with the slope and the wind now in their favour. As Coleshill tired, so Sphinx plied on the pressure and a minute after having a penalty plea turned down they finally breached the Town rearguard with a firm header. If Coleshill were lucky to get away with the penalty decision they were unlucky with the winning goal as several players seemed to impede Moseley before bundling the ball over the goal line. Moseley felt hard done by and was booked for his persistent decent. Suddenly Sphinx were world beaters and gloated in their eventual victory but they were pushed all the way by the makeshift visitors. The new management will have to bring in new players, but the commitment and attitude is present in most of the remaining squad so they will have something to work on in the next few weeks.


Team:- Danny Moseley, Neil Anderson, Frank Woodburn, Lee McClean (James Butterworth), Adam Whyte, Pete Hall, Tony Gormley, Gallagher, Mitchell Thompson, Craig Davies, Danny Carter (Gary Horsburgh). Sub not used Brett Dalton.
